Former England Footballer Bryan Robson has joined the IR35 Decade Club despite winning most of his appeal to the First-tier Tax Tribunal. The case centres on services Robson provided to Manchester United as a Global Ambassador from 2015/16 to 2020/21 via his company, Bryan Robson Limited. Tribunal ruling could encourage more inside IR35 limited company freelancers to reclaim unlawful Employer’s National Insurance Contributions THIS ARTICLE WAS UPDATED AT 14:00 ON 09.01.25 A social worker engaged by the Home Office has successfully claimed nearly £37,000 (£36,826.65) from a recruitment agency after an employment tribunal deemed that “unlawful deductions” had been made from their pay. Gary Lineker’s high-profile IR35 dispute with HMRC has finally concluded, with the two parties reaching an out-of-court settlement. While the exact details remain confidential, the case offers valuable lessons for freelancers about navigating the complexities of IR35 legislation. The choice between operating as a sole trader or setting up a limited company can have significant implications for freelancers and startup founders. One key factor driving many freelancers towards the latter is the enhanced protection it offers for their personal assets, including their family home. A survey by the British Chambers of Commerce (BCC) reveals a worsening recruitment crisis in the UK and IR35 could be at the heart of it The survey of over 4,700 businesses found that 74% reported recruitment difficulties in Q2 2024, a significant increase from 66% in Q1.
